Job Title: Maintenance Facilities Supervisor

Location: Ikoyi, Lagos
Employment Type: Full-time

Responsibilities

  • Daily inspection of all service equipment’s/utilities in the building (with checklist). Act on all ensuing issues.
  • Develop checklists for the assigned facility and monitor same.
  • Report back to the Maintenance Manager on regular basis.
  • Monitor of all service equipment’s to minimize down time.
  • Implementation of all maintenance schedules preplanned for routine maintenance activities.
  • Available primary contact to company clients on their facilities issues.
  • Assessment of facility maintenance requirements and material estimates for procurements.
  • Supervision of all maintenance works and facilities renovations by company contractors to ensure works are done to company defined standards and scopes.
  • Solve building maintenance problems should they occur.
  • Effective utilization and supervision of the maintenance team consisting of plumbers, electricians, cleaners etc. to achieve good service delivery to the company customers.
  • Logging of maintenance activities/breakdowns.
  • Attend periodic maintenance department meetings.
  • Intermediary between the maintenance team and other departments in the company.
  • Follow up with Accounts on maintenance requests, reporting status on a regular basis to (FMM).
  • Record keeping of job cards for each flat.
  • Record keeping of expenditure for each flat.
  • Record keeping and updating of service history of all company plant & equipment.
  • Inventory control.
  • Provide HSE admin support to the department staff and assist with producing reports on HSE.
  • Perform all other maintenance, mechanical and administrative duties as assigned by Line Manager.
  • Assist in sourcing for contractors and materials for procurement.
  • Assist in monitoring of staff attendance and collation of attendance registers for HR.
  • Regular checks on building HSE and security related measures to ensure compliance with standards.
  • Assist in monitoring of diesel levels in facilities and all other duties as assigned or required by Line Manager.

Education and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Electrical, Mechanical any related field.
  • Engineering and Health & Safety Certifications will be an added advantage. E.g. COREN, HSE 1, 2, 3. First Aid, Fire-fighting, Work a height, COSHH, HVAC, IOSH working safely or managing safely etc.

Experience:

  • Minimum of 5 years experience as a maintenance supervisor.
  • Strong knowledge of building trades and maintenance.
  • Solid understanding of health and safety regulations and practices.
